Navigating Repair Negotiations After a Home Inspection in Indian Shores, FL: Essential Dos and Don’ts

Buying a home is an exciting milestone, but it also entails a series of essential steps to ensure you are making a sound investment. One crucial aspect of the home-buying process is the home inspection, which provides valuable insights into the property’s condition. After receiving the inspection report, you might find yourself facing a negotiation with the seller over repairs and other related issues. Navigating repair negotiations after a home inspection in Indian Shores, FL can be tricky. To help you make the most of the situation, here are some essential dos and don’ts.

Do:

  • Research the inspection report in detail, so you can understand the scope of the repairs needed.
  • Make sure you understand the rules and regulations in Indian Shores, FL, so you don’t mistakenly ask for something that isn’t allowed.
  • Be realistic in your expectations, and strive for a fair compromise with the seller.
  • Be prepared to pay for some repairs yourself if necessary.
  • Consult with a real estate attorney if the negotiations become too complicated.

Don’t:

  • Make unreasonable demands or attempt to take advantage of the seller.
  • Be too hasty in making a decision, as you may miss out on beneficial solutions.
  • Make any commitments until you’ve discussed the situation with your real estate agent.
  • Attempt to conduct the negotiations without the assistance of a professional.

Navigating repair negotiations after a home inspection in Indian Shores, FL can be challenging if you don’t have the right approach. If you follow the above dos and don’ts, you should be able to come to an agreement with the seller that works for both parties.
